Step 2: Add 6 to Both Sides
To isolate the term containing a, add 6 to both sides of the equation:
3a - 6 + 6 = 12 + 6
Simplifying both sides gives:
3a = 18
Now, the variable a is multiplied only by 3.
Step 3: Divide Both Sides by 3
To solve for a, divide both sides of the equation by 3:
3a ÷ 3 = 18 ÷ 3
This simplifies to:
a = 6
